Cyclops was slain very publicly in a plot by the fiendish Doctor Stasis! Hmm, maybe I could get a job writing solicits. Brevoort, holla. I do love that it's Emma who's there to resurrect him and stroke his brow. Jean is off planet, but it's known that they do this on the reg. The secret of Krakoan resurrection protocols must be protected, so the world believes he is truly dead for now.
The Quiet Council forces him to alpha test a battle suit built by Forge intended to protect non-combatants. Using it to pose as CAPTAIN KRAKOA, Scott visits his own memorial at the X-Men's New York treehouse. Duggan really twists the knife here with this devastated child and a wonderfully sincere public memorial. Sure, the Quiet Council or X-Force might have put it on to sell the secret, but there are strangers there weeping over his passing.
Cyclops was this kid's favourite and now he's sad. I really didn't expect this to be honest and it made me emotional. Perhaps it's the soul cruising 'hated and feared'/Cyclops is mutant Hitler stuff the previous decades had been filled with, but I didn't imagine Cyke having fans like this. We've seen them before and he's been on the cover of Rolling Stone, but compared to his previous public death it's night and day.
